So she quickly finished her breakfast and followed Chu Yixin to the main room.

I glanced into the study, but no one was there.

"Perhaps the master is in his bedroom. Would you like to go and check?"

Jiang Zhuoying nodded, not yet noticing the change in the other person's address, and simply turned around in another direction.

Stepping into the bedroom, I glanced around; no one was there.

She hesitated for a few moments, then walked around the screen and called out, "Your Highness?"

Upon entering the other side of the screen, there was still no one there.

Where did that hypocrite go?

What are you doing here?

The two spoke at the same time, and Jiang Zhuoying froze, cold sweat suddenly pouring down her back.

She stiffened and turned around, only to find the person walking out of the hidden door, wearing only underwear, his upper body wet, the muscles of his chest and abdomen clearly visible, and a bath towel casually draped over his shoulders.

The girl suddenly turned around, her hands clenched into fists, her voice shrill: "How could you do this!"

How could anyone build a bathhouse inside a hidden door?!

"What did you call me just now?" The voice was hoarse and cold.

Jiang Zhuoying broke out in a cold sweat even more profusely. She swallowed hard and said, "Your Highness, I'm calling for you."

"Really?" The two words, spoken slowly, sent a chill down her spine.

"Do you know what punishment you will receive for deceiving me?"

He spoke of punishment, but his tone remained calm, showing no sign of anger.

The footsteps behind her slowly approached, and Jiang Zhuoying suddenly turned around with her eyes closed.

The girl lowered her head, her voice soft: "I didn't mean to..."

"Since you addressed him as Your Highness, why apologize?"

The girl paused noticeably, her voice becoming even more slurred: "Second Prince, I'm sorry..."

The man's breathing was slightly heavier than before, and his voice was deep: "You dare to say anything, but you don't dare to open your eyes?"

He looked down at the stiff little girl, noticing her fair ears gradually turning pink, her voice trembling as she lowered her head, and her slender fingers fidgeting.

"Go wait in the study."

Jiang Zhuoying felt as if she had been granted a pardon. She nodded hurriedly and quickly turned and slipped away.

...

She arrived at the study with lingering fear, only to find Chu Yixin waiting there, clutching the same secret letter as always.

Chu Yixin's eyes lit up when she saw her: "Miss Jiang, have you seen your master?"

Jiang Zhuoying nodded absentmindedly, "Mm."

"Why didn't the master come along?" He glanced back twice.

"Oh, she's changing."

You can't come out with your upper body bare, can you?

"Oh, changing clothes..."

Jiang Zhuoying was taken aback, and when she turned around, she met Eunuch Chu's bright eyes.

"No, Eunuch Chu, His Highness just finished bathing."

"Yes, yes, I understand! My family has served in the palace before, what haven't we seen?"

Chu Yixin comforted her with a smile, her expression more joyful than ever before.

Jiang Zhuoying: "..."

If she stays here any longer, her reputation may be ruined.

"Sir? You've arrived?"

Chu Yixin suddenly bowed respectfully behind Jiang Zhuoying.

Jiang Zhuoying pinched her thumb and forefinger, then turned around and curtsied.

She knew that Chu Yixin had sent a secret letter, and she wondered if she could glean any insights from it.

"Why are you still standing here?" he asked, his tone displeased.

The girl stood frozen in place, stammering uncertainly, "Then...where should I stand?"

Seeing that she was still in a daze as before, Qi Fan pursed his thin lips and pointed to the soft couch by the window: "Go."

"...Thank you, Your Highness."

Jiang Zhuoying turned around, her back to Qi Fan and Chu Yixin, took a deep breath, and calmed herself down...

She had already heard palace secrets at Yuanbao Tower.

As the girl slowly leaned back on the soft couch, changed into a more comfortable position, and then gently nibbled on the fish and lean meat porridge that had been specially prepared for her on the kang table.

Qi Fan withdrew his gaze, and Chu Yixin immediately presented the secret letter in her hand.

Jiang Zhuoying chewed on the bland porridge, but her peripheral vision and ears were meticulously focused on the direction of the desk.

The sound of the letter being torn...

Then the room was quiet for a while.

"My third brother wants to choose a concubine."

Qi Fan raised his hand and handed the letter to Chu Yixin.

Jiang Zhuoying paused, "A concubine?"

Jiang Ying is the principal wife, but she hasn't even officially married into the family yet, and they're already starting to select concubines?

Isn't this a bit too hasty?

Chu Yixin suddenly exclaimed in surprise, "The Third Prince's mistress is already pregnant?"

Jiang Zhuoying: "???"

The sound of the spoon hitting the porcelain bowl was crisp and pleasant.

Both of them looked towards the girl on the soft couch—

Qi Fan raised an eyebrow almost imperceptibly: "What?"

Jiang Zhuoying barely managed to steady herself, picked up a handkerchief from the side to wipe the corner of her mouth, and after a moment's thought, spoke softly.

"Is what Eunuch Chu said just now true? I was just too surprised."

Upon hearing this, Chu Yixin glanced at her master and, having received tacit approval, nodded in explanation.

"Yes, according to the scouts, the Third Prince's mistress is pregnant."

He glanced at Jiang Zhuoying, then at Qi Fan.

Before even entering the main wife's household, his concubine was already pregnant; the Third Prince was truly shameless.

But then he thought again, it was indeed the Third Prince's child, so why was his master completely unmoved?

Jiang Zhuoying did not hide her surprise. If she wasn't surprised, then it would be suspicious.

Right now, she only has Jiang Ying in her heart. Jiang Ying is her uncle's legitimate daughter and has been raised as a true lady of a prominent family since childhood.

Well-mannered, dutiful, knowledgeable and reasonable...

Although her relationship with Jiang Ying wasn't exactly intimate, it wasn't bad either.

She knew Jiang Ying well; given Jiang Ying's personality, her marriage would definitely be decided entirely by her parents.

She was obedient from a young age; in her words, she was filial and obedient.

But the affair being pregnant...

She couldn't bear to watch her jump into the fire, even though her fake smallpox was most likely related to her uncle and his family.

However, she had not yet investigated the matter thoroughly and could not be certain that it was related to Jiang Ying.

After several rounds of deliberation, she had made up her mind.

She wants to attend the Third Prince's birthday banquet too!

When she made her decision and looked up again, she found that Eunuch Chu had already disappeared.

As for the aloof and profound Second Prince, he had already taken his seat behind the desk.

Jiang Zhuoying glanced at the porridge in her hand, then suddenly spoke in a sweet and soft voice, "...Second Prince, you are so good to me."

The man's right hand, which was holding the wolf-hair brush, paused slightly. He slowly raised his head and narrowed his eyes.

He hadn't said anything, but Jiang Zhuoying knew what he meant.

The girl continued in a soft voice, "This porridge melts in your mouth, and the fish slices and lean meat inside are fragrant and tender. I suppose it was specially ordered for me by the Second Prince?"

The man remained expressionless: "Hmm."

The girl was flattered and surprised: "I never thought that the Second Prince really cared about me!"

"In that case, after much thought, I've decided to repay you."

Qi Fan finally looked at him properly, his voice indifferent: "Have you thought it through?"

Jiang Zhuoying choked for a moment, then said coquettishly, "Second Prince, you really are something. You clearly promised me a three-month deadline, how can you go back on your word?"

Qi Fan lowered his eyes, staring at the marriage proposal on the table.

The time is not yet right.

For him, it made no difference whether it was March or the third day.

No matter what, she can only be his.

He heard his own low, hoarse voice ask: "How do you want to repay me?"

The girl licked her lips: "Yesterday, His Highness said that he originally wanted to invite me to the Third Prince's birthday celebration?"

The man looked up, his gaze sharp and intense, making her feel uneasy.

"Well, I was just thinking that the Third Prince clearly invited me, but if I didn't go, wouldn't that be disrespecting you?"

"If word gets out that this matter, and people say that even the concubines in the Second Prince's room dare to disobey him, wouldn't that damage the Second Prince's prestige?"

"So?" The man's eyes held a half-smile.

"So, after much thought, I decided it would be best to accompany my brother, the Second Prince."

Qi Fan didn't take her change of heart seriously.

The young girl is naturally fickle, and it's perfectly normal for her to be curious and unusual after learning about her third brother's situation.

He nodded casually, granting her request.

The Third Prince's birthday is in half a month. During this period, Jiang Zhuoying is kept under close watch, and she can't find a chance to leave the mansion alone. Naturally, she can't meet with Xiangyue.

Half a month later, the wound on her shoulder had healed, but just as Ah Liu had said, a long scar remained on the surface.

Eunuch Chu brought a lot of scar-removing ointment. Although Jiang Zhuoying felt bad, she had no choice but to accept it since things had come to this.

She applied different scar-removing creams every day, hoping the scar would fade as much as possible.

Besides, Jiang Zhuoying also went to the study every day, but instead of being the one serving others, she became the one being served.

The soft couch in the study had become her territory, piled high with pillows, cushions, and even the soft mats had been replaced with her favorite patterns.

The kitchen in the courtyard would also send her delicious food every day, not only with different dishes but also with careful preparation, which was very beneficial to the recovery of her wounds.

As for the desk prepared for her, she hasn't even sat on it lately.

Whenever a man showed any interest, she would raise her arms and whine.

"Second Prince, you are so cruel. Seeing that I am so badly injured, you still have to make me unhappy."

Upon hearing this, Qi Fan glanced at her indifferently and did not urge her any further.

These days, Jiang Zhuoying no longer needs to avoid the situation; she has overheard many secrets of the court in this unassuming study.

For example, the head of the Imperial Medical Academy was a man of the Second Prince.

The Prime Minister is afraid of his wife.

The Third Prince's favorite concubines are the daughter of the Minister of War and the daughter of the Prefect of the Capital...

Even Jiang Zhuoying, a sheltered young lady who never concerned herself with court affairs, knew that this third prince was indeed ambitious.

The emperor is still alive, yet he wishes he could marry every young lady who could be of benefit to him.

I wonder if his princely residence can accommodate him!

Finding a spare moment, Jiang Zhuoying, with a stern face, secretly wrote down everything she knew about the Third Prince's outrageous deeds.

She had to find a way to deliver this message to Jiang Ying at the Third Prince's birthday banquet.

But the most difficult thing she faced was not how to deliver the message, but how to deliver the message with such a face.

She must not be recognized by Jiang Ying.

After much thought, Jiang Zhuoying could only come up with one solution: to cover her face with a veil on the day of her birthday banquet.

...

On the day of the Third Prince's birthday banquet, Jiang Zhuoying wore a moon-white gauze dress with a high waist. She had thought it through and decided that she should wear a more low-key color to avoid attracting attention.

However, since the color is so understated, the style cannot be too understated either, otherwise it would be inappropriate for it to stand next to the Second Prince.

This ruqun (a type of traditional Chinese dress) appears understated and reserved, while the gauze fabric adds a touch of lightness. Most importantly, it matches her face towel perfectly, creating a harmonious look.

Jiang Zhuoying was very satisfied with her appearance until she excitedly walked out of the room, only to be hit hard by a single sentence from someone.

The man's face was cold and stern, and his tone brooked no argument: "Go back and change into a dress."

The girl's eyes widened: "Why?"

"Is it not pretty?"

Qi Fan lowered his eyes and stared at the ethereal girl in front of him. He didn't know why she was wearing a face mask today. Her white gauze dress stood in the light and shadow, her slender waist was like water, and she was as pure as a fairy descended to earth.

After a long silence, under Jiang Zhuoying's increasingly suspicious gaze, he swallowed hard and said, "It's not appropriate."

Too attractive.

The girl immediately replied, her brows furrowed: "What part is unsuitable?"

The man remained expressionless and said calmly, "It's windy today, and this material is too thin."

Jiang Zhuoying: "..."

The reason was perfectly valid, but she remained frozen in place: "I'm not cold."

The man remained unmoved.
